When a water heater is functioning accurately, most individuals don’t pay it any thoughts. Nonetheless, one crucial part of a water heater is the strain reduction valve. It’s designed to open if the strain contained in the heater turns into too excessive, normally as a consequence of a malfunction inside the equipment. A defective valve will be harmful, however happily, it’s simple to take away and change. In case you are experiencing water heater points, the reduction valve could must be changed or cleaned. Removing of the valve is step one to resolving the problem.
Earlier than you start, flip off the gasoline to the water heater or disconnect the water heater from the circuit breaker that provides it with energy. This can forestall any gasoline or electrical energy from reaching the water heater when you are engaged on it. Activate a scorching water faucet someplace in the home to alleviate any strain contained in the tank. Subsequent, connect a bucket or hose to the top of the discharge pipe coming from the reduction valve and place the opposite finish of the hose in a location that may deal with water circulation.
As soon as the whole lot is ready, you can begin the removing course of. First, place a wrench across the prime of the strain reduction valve. Make sure you have a agency grip on it. Then, slowly start turning it counterclockwise. There could also be some resistance at first, however with continued turning, the valve will finally loosen. As soon as it’s unfastened, proceed turning till it’s fully out of the heater. Examine the valve for any harm or buildup, reminiscent of calcium deposits, which can be limiting its motion. If any buildup is current, clear it off with a wire brush or vinegar.
Figuring out the Strain Aid Valve
The strain reduction valve is a crucial security gadget that stops your water heater from exploding as a consequence of extreme strain buildup. It’s usually situated on the highest or facet of the water heater tank.
Look and Location:
- Form: The valve resembles a small brass or plastic cylinder with a lever or deal with on prime.
- Dimensions: It normally measures round 2-4 inches in size and 1-2 inches in diameter.
- Materials: Most valves are fabricated from brass, however some are fabricated from plastic or chrome steel.
- Lever or Deal with: The valve has a lever or deal with that may be lifted or pulled to open the valve.
- Discharge Pipe: A discharge pipe is related to the valve to direct any launched water to a secure location.
Perform and Goal:
The strain reduction valve operates robotically to launch extra strain from the water heater. When the water strain contained in the tank exceeds a predetermined restrict (normally 150-200 psi), the valve opens to permit water to flee. This prevents the tank from bursting and probably inflicting vital harm and harm.

Finding the Water Provide Shut-Off
Figuring out the water provide shut-off valve is essential earlier than beginning any work on the water heater. Usually, it’s situated close to the water heater, both on the wall or popping out of the ground near the equipment. It normally has a deal with or lever that may be turned or lifted to cease the water circulation.
When you can’t discover the shut-off valve close to the water heater, examine the primary water provide line exterior your house. The primary shut-off valve is normally discovered the place the primary water line enters your property, both within the basement, crawl area, or utility room. When you encounter any difficulties finding the shut-off valve, it’s advisable to contact a licensed plumber for help.
